Thai Basil Chicken with Jasmine Rice

Thai Basil Chicken with Jasmine Rice is a vibrant, fragrant dish featuring tender chicken stir-fried with garlic, chilies, and a rich blend of umami sauces, finished with fresh basil leaves. Served over fluffy jasmine rice, this meal offers the perfect balance of heat, aroma, and savory depth, capturing the essence of Thai street-food cuisine.

Why You’ll Love This Recipe

This dish is quick to prepare yet delivers powerful flavor. The combination of garlic, chilies, and Thai basil creates a bold and aromatic profile that is both satisfying and comforting. It cooks in minutes, uses accessible ingredients, and tastes remarkably authentic. Whether for a speedy weeknight dinner or a flavorful lunch, this recipe consistently impresses.

Ingredients

  • 2 cups cooked jasmine rice

  • 1 pound chicken breast, thinly sliced

  • 1 tablespoon vegetable oil

  • 4 cloves garlic, minced

  • 2 Thai chilies (or red chili flakes to taste)

  • 1 red bell pepper, sliced

  • 2 cups fresh basil leaves

  • 2 tablespoons soy sauce

  • 1 tablespoon fish sauce

  • 1 tablespoon oyster sauce

  • 1 teaspoon sugar

(Tip: You can find the complete list of ingredients and their measurements in the recipe card below.)

Directions

  1. Cook the jasmine rice according to package instructions and keep warm.

  2. Heat the vegetable oil in a skillet or wok over medium-high heat.

  3. Add the minced garlic and Thai chilies, sautéing briefly until fragrant.

  4. Add the sliced chicken breast and cook until no longer pink.

  5. Stir in the red bell pepper and cook for 2–3 minutes.

  6. Add soy sauce, fish sauce, oyster sauce, and sugar. Stir thoroughly to coat the chicken evenly.

  7. Continue cooking until the sauce reduces slightly and the chicken is fully cooked.

  8. Add the fresh basil leaves and toss until just wilted.

  9. Serve hot over jasmine rice.

Servings and Timing

  • Servings: 4

  • Preparation time: 10 minutes

  • Cooking time: 10 minutes

  • Total time: 20 minutes

Variations

  • Use ground chicken for a more traditional Thai basil chicken texture.

  • Replace chicken with shrimp, tofu, or beef.

  • Add green beans or mushrooms for added texture.

  • Use holy basil for an even more authentic Thai flavor.

  • Add a fried egg on top for the classic Thai street-style presentation.

Storage/Reheating

Store leftovers in an airtight container in the refrigerator for up to 3 days. Reheat in a skillet over medium heat with a splash of water to revive the sauce. Microwave reheating is also suitable but may soften the basil further.

FAQs

Can I make this dish less spicy?

Yes, use fewer chilies or substitute with mild red pepper flakes.

Can I use dried basil?

Fresh basil is essential for the correct flavor and texture; dried basil is not recommended.

What type of basil should I use?

Thai basil is ideal, but sweet basil can be used if Thai basil is unavailable.

Can I make this recipe gluten-free?

Use gluten-free soy sauce and gluten-free fish sauce.

Is jasmine rice necessary?

Jasmine rice provides authentic aroma and texture, but basmati rice is an acceptable substitute.

Can I double the sauce?

Yes, increase all sauce ingredients proportionally for extra sauciness.

Can I make it vegetarian?

Use tofu instead of chicken and replace fish sauce with soy sauce or a plant-based fish-sauce alternative.

Why did my chicken turn tough?

Overcooking chicken breast can cause dryness; cook only until just done.

Can I meal-prep this dish?

Yes, it reheats well and works great for weekday lunches.

Can I add more vegetables?

Absolutely—bell peppers, snap peas, and carrots all complement the flavors.

Conclusion

Thai Basil Chicken with Jasmine Rice is a fast, flavorful dish that brings authentic Thai taste to your kitchen with minimal effort. Its combination of aromatic herbs, savory sauces, and tender chicken creates a satisfying meal suitable for any day of the week. Enjoy the bold, comforting, and perfectly balanced flavors this recipe provides.

Print

Thai Basil Chicken with Jasmine Rice

A flavorful and aromatic Thai stir-fry made with tender chicken, fresh basil, and savory sauce, served over fragrant jasmine rice.

  • Author: Mariem
  • Prep Time: 10 mins
  • Cook Time: 15 mins
  • Total Time: 25 mins
  • Yield: 4 servings 1x
  • Category: Main Dish
  • Method: Stir-Fry
  • Cuisine: Thai
  • Diet: Low Fat

Ingredients

Scale
  • 1 lb chicken breast or thighs, thinly sliced
  • 2 tbsp vegetable oil
  • 4 cloves garlic, minced
  • 2 shallots, sliced
  • 12 Thai chilies, sliced (optional for heat)
  • 2 tbsp soy sauce
  • 1 tbsp oyster sauce
  • 1 tbsp fish sauce
  • 1 tsp sugar
  • 1/4 cup chicken broth or water
  • 1 cup fresh Thai basil leaves
  • 3 cups cooked jasmine rice

Instructions

  1. Heat the oil in a large pan or wok over medium-high heat.
  2. Add garlic, shallots, and chilies. Stir-fry for 1 minute until fragrant.
  3. Add the sliced chicken and cook until no longer pink.
  4. Stir in soy sauce, oyster sauce, fish sauce, and sugar.
  5. Pour in the chicken broth and cook for 2–3 minutes until the sauce thickens slightly.
  6. Turn off the heat and stir in the Thai basil leaves until wilted.
  7. Serve hot over jasmine rice.

Notes

  • For a healthier version, use low-sodium soy sauce.
  • Substitute Thai basil with sweet basil if unavailable.
  • Add vegetables like bell peppers or green beans for extra nutrition.

Nutrition

  • Serving Size: 1 plate
  • Calories: 420
  • Sugar: 5g
  • Sodium: 780mg
  • Fat: 12g
  • Saturated Fat: 2g
  • Unsaturated Fat: 9g
  • Trans Fat: 0g
  • Carbohydrates: 53g
  • Fiber: 1g
  • Protein: 28g
  • Cholesterol: 75mg

Keywords: thai basil chicken, jasmine rice, thai stir fry, pad krapow gai

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ating